RESUMO

PURPOSE: To evaluate the effect of microRNA (miR)-124 on osteogenic differentiation of dental pulp mesenchymal stem cells (DPSCs) and to explore the possible mechanism. METHODS: Logarithmic DPSCs were collected and divided into blank group, no-load group, miR-124 inhibitor group, miR-124 inhibitor combined with N-[N-(3,5-difluorophenacetyl)-1-alanyl]-S-ph (DAPT, Notch signaling pathway inhibitor) group. The blank group was not treated, the empty group was transfected with negative control vector inhibitor-NC, the miR-124 inhibitor group was transfected with miR-124 inhibitor, the miR-124 inhibitor combined with DAPT group was transfected with miR-124 inhibitor, and DAPT was added to make the final concentration of 5 µmol/L. The proliferation ability was tested by CCK-8 method 48 h after transfection. Alkaline phosphatase (ALP) activity was tested by p-nitrophenyl phosphate (P-NPP) method after 2 weeks of induction. The area of calcified nodules was tested by alizarin red staining method. The protein expression of hair-like division-related enhancer 1 (HEY1), hair-like division-related enhancer 2 (HEY2), and cyclin D1 gene (CCND1) were tested by Western blot. The data was analyzed by SPSS 19.0 software package. RESULTS: Compared with the blank group and no-load group, the A450 value at 24, 48, 72 h detected by CCK-8 experiment, A450 value of ALP activity, the area composition ratio of calcified nodules, and expression of HEY1, HEY2, and CCND1 in the miR-124 inhibitor group were increased (P<0.05). Compared with miR-124 inhibitor group, the A450 value at 24, 48, 72 h detected by CCK-8 experiment, A450 value of ALP activity, the area composition ratio of calcified nodules, and the expression of HEY1, HEY2, and CCND1 in the miR-124 inhibitor combined with DAPT group were significantly decreased(P<0.05). CONCLUSIONS: Down-regulation of miR-124 can promote osteogenic differentiation of DPSCs. It is speculated that the mechanism of action is related to the activation of Notch signaling pathway.

RESUMO

PURPOSE: To investigate the current status of dental caries and periodontal diseases in the population aged 35-44 and 65-74 years in Jiangxi province, and to provide information for prevention of these diseases. METHODS: 1584 people (aged 35-44 and 65-74 years) were selected by equal-sized stratified multi- stage and random sampling. Their dental caries and periodontal diseases were examined in routine epidemiologic surgery manner. Student's t test and Chi-square test were applied for statistical analysis using SPSS12.0 software package. RESULTS: In the age group of 35-44 and 65-74 years, the prevalence rate of dental caries was 59.4% and 85.5%, the mean DMFT was 2.19 and 4.91, the prevalence rate of root caries was 32.7% and 79.5%, the mean DFRoot was 0.28 and 1.25,the rate of healthy periodontal tissues was 0.1% and 5.3%. CONCLUSIONS: Dental caries and periodontal diseases are quite common diseases in Jiangxi Province. We should reinforce the oral health care and the propaganda for oral care knowledge in order to treat caries and periodontal diseases better and earlier, and improve the life quality of middle-aged and elderly citizens.
